Lines Matching defs:from
47 // The number of slots we reserve per translation map from mapping page tables.
79 // Used when copying from/to user memory. This can cause a page fault
152 virtual status_t MemcpyFromPhysical(void* to, phys_addr_t from,
155 const void* from, size_t length, bool user);
157 phys_addr_t from);
361 // get our slots from the global pool
530 // get a slot from the per-cpu user pool
605 LargeMemoryPhysicalPageMapper::MemcpyFromPhysical(void* _to, phys_addr_t from,
609 addr_t pageOffset = from % B_PAGE_SIZE;
622 slot->Map(from - pageOffset);
633 from += toCopy;
648 const uint8* from = (const uint8*)_from;
665 error = user_memcpy((void*)(slot->address + pageOffset), from,
670 memcpy((void*)(slot->address + pageOffset), from, toCopy);
673 from += toCopy;
686 phys_addr_t from)
697 fromSlot->Map(from);